WebbLocation Royal Air Force (RAF) Station Lakenheath, Suffolk, United Kingdom, is located 70 miles northwest of London and 25 miles from Cambridge. The closest town is Lakenheath village which is located two miles from the base. RAF Mildenhall and Mildenhall village are approximately seven miles away. WebbLakenheath is a village and civil parish in the West Suffolk district of Suffolk in eastern England. It has a population of 4,691 according to the 2011 Census, and is situated close to the county boundaries of both Norfolk and Cambridgeshire, and at the meeting point of The Fens and the Breckland natural environments.. It takes an average of 30m to travel from Cambridge to Lakenheath by train, over a distance of around 24 miles (39 km). There are normally 2 trains per day travelling from Cambridge to Lakenheath and tickets for this journey start from £11.30 when you book in advance.
